Molyneux started to get a somewhat bad reputation because of being overly ambitious. Black and White was supposed to be all that and a bag of chips but it wasn't. What it really was, was an amazing AI system dropped into a mega-micromanagement nightmare. Seems they spent too much time with the AI and not nearly enough on the gameplay. I played it for about a week, hoping it would get better and it didn't. It's collecting dust in the same place since then. There was way less micromanagment in the Command and Conquer games than in B&W...uhg.

After that debacle, I'm a bit gunshy on Molyneux. I'd love to see codename Ego be a fantastic game but I'm reserving judgement until it's playable.
